Ocean Yachts was founded in 1977 in Mullica, New Jersey by John Leek IV�s grandfather, John Leek Jr., after he and partners sold Pacemaker Yachts. The Leek family has quite a boat building legacy that dates to the early 1700s. Although Ocean yachts are no longer in production, after the Mullica River facility was sold to Viking Yachts of New Gretna in 2015, John Leek IV, 14th generation boat builder, continues to build boats at the Viking Yachts Mullica boatyard.
The Leek family boat building DNA is evident in the Ocean Yachts 70 Super Sport. Ocean Yachts� interiors combine beauty and ingenious utilization of space that is a hallmark of William Bales and Company, marine interior design firm that served as Ocean Yachts� exclusive stylist since its founding in 1977 and helped propel Ocean yachts to become one of the world�s leading yacht manufacturers. Ocean yachts continue to be appreciated for their excellent build, seaworthy performance, and beauty.
